Abstract: A time domain version of linear sampling method (LSM) is developed for elastic wave imaging of media including scatterers with arbitrary geometries. The LSM is an effective approach to image the geometrical features of unknown targets from multi-view data collected from measurement of casual waves. This study emphasizes the exploitation of the LSM using spectral finite element method (SFEM). A comprehensive set of numerical simulations on two-dimensional elastodynamic problems is presented to highlight many efficient features of the proposed fast qualitative LSM identification method such as its ability to locate an inclusion (e.g., a crack) and estimate its dimensions.
